The Partial Nuclear Test Ban Treaty, banning nuclear tests in the atmosphere, in outer space, and under water by the United States, United Kingdom, and Soviet Union, went into effect on October 10, 1963, after ratification.
The treaty was a major Cold War arms-control milestone that reduced radioactive fallout, eased superpower tensions, and established a precedent for future nuclear arms agreements.
